This quintessential release includes Gene Vincent’s sensational fourth LP, A Gene Vincent Record Date, originally issued by Capitol Records in November 1958, and long unavailable on vinyl. Although the album did not contain smash hits, it’s filled with lots of solid rockers and ballads in Vincent’s characteristic style.
In addition to the original album, this WaxTime collector’s edition contains 2 bonus tracks, consisting of hard-to-find-sides from the same period: “Lotta Lovin’” and “I Got It.”
PERSONNEL:
GENE VINCENT, vocals and guitar, plus:
Johnny Meeks (lead guitar), Max Lipscomb (rhythm guitar and piano),
Grady Owen (guitar), Bobby Lee Jones (bass), Cliff Simmons (piano),
Dickie Harrell or Juvez Gomez (drums), Jackie Kelso (tenor saxophone),
Plas Johnson (baritone saxophone),
The Clapper Boys: Paul Peek and Tommy “Bubba” Facenda (backing vocals and hand claps).
Recorded at Capitol Tower Studios, Hollywood, California, 1958.
(*) BONUS TRACKS (“Lotta Lsovin’” & “I Got It”):
Johnny Meeks (lead guitar), Buck Owens (rhythm guitar)
Bobby Lee Jones (bass), Dickie Harrell (drums).
Recorded at Capitol Tower Studios, Hollywood, California, June 19, 1957.
